线性回归法与Matlab在复摆实验中测定重力加速度
版权申诉
98 浏览量
更新于2024-11-22
收藏 137KB ZIP 举报
文件中包含了关于使用线性回归方法和Matlab软件进行复摆(复合摆)实验来测量重力加速度(g)的详细内容。以下是基于文件标题和描述所提取的知识点:
1. 线性回归法的基本概念:线性回归是一种统计学方法,用来确定两种或两种以上变量间相互依赖的定量关系。在复摆测重力加速度实验中,线性回归用于处理数据,推导出变量间的线性关系,从而得到重力加速度的精确值。
2. 复摆测重力加速度的实验原理:复摆是由一个具有质量的刚性杆与一个可以绕通过其质心的水平轴自由转动的摆动系统。在复摆实验中,通过测量摆动周期和摆动角度,可以计算出当地的重力加速度。
3. Matlab软件简介:Matlab是一种高性能的数值计算和可视化软件,广泛应用于工程计算、数据分析、算法开发等领域。Matlab提供了一个交互式环境,支持矩阵运算、函数绘图和数据拟合等多种功能。
4. 在Matlab中处理复摆数据:使用Matlab进行数据处理,需要将复摆实验所测得的数据输入Matlab环境中。这些数据可能包括摆动周期、摆动角度等。利用Matlab强大的数学处理能力,可以对数据进行线性拟合,以确定与周期相关的系数。
5. 利用线性回归确定重力加速度:在Matlab中,通过选择合适的线性回归模型,将实验数据进行线性拟合,从而找到最佳拟合线。根据拟合直线的斜率,可以计算出重力加速度的值。
6. 复摆实验操作步骤:文件可能详细介绍了复摆实验的步骤,包括设置实验装置、测量不同摆长下的周期、记录数据等。这些步骤对确保实验结果的准确性至关重要。
7. 数据处理与分析:在Matlab中完成数据输入后,进行必要的数据清洗和预处理,然后使用线性回归模型对数据进行分析,得到回归方程。通过分析回归方程的斜率,可以间接计算出重力加速度。
8. 实验误差分析:任何物理实验都存在误差,复摆实验也不例外。文件可能提供了关于如何使用Matlab分析实验数据中可能存在的随机误差和系统误差,以及如何校正这些误差的方法。
9. 结果验证:最终,可以将通过线性回归方法和Matlab计算得到的重力加速度值与理论值或其他测量方法得到的值进行对比,验证实验结果的准确性和可靠性。
10. Matlab高级功能:在完成基础的线性拟合任务后,文件可能还会介绍Matlab的高级功能,如优化工具箱、图形用户界面(GUI)创建等,这些可以帮助进一步优化数据分析过程和提高实验报告的质量。
通过以上知识点,可以全面了解线性回归法和Matlab在复摆测重力加速度实验中的应用,并掌握相应的理论知识和实践技能。
基于PLC的S7-200组态王智能小区路灯节能控制系统详解:梯形图程序、接线图与组态画面全解析,基于PLC的S7-200组态王智能小区路灯节能控制系统详解:梯形图程序、接线图与组态画面全解析,S7-2
1916 浏览量
基于粒子群算法的配电网经济调度优化策略:考虑风光、储能与成本的综合分析,基于粒子群算法的配电网日前优化调度方案:经济环保,考虑储能与潮流约束的电源出力优化,基于粒子群算法的配电网日前优化调度 采用IE
2025-02-26 上传
2025-02-26 上传
2025-02-26 上传

mYlEaVeiSmVp
- 粉丝: 2264
最新资源
- 理解AJAX基础与实现
- BEA Tuxedo精华贴总结:程序示例与环境变量设置
- TUXEDO函数详解:tpalloc, tprealloc, tpfree, tptypes与FML操作
- Windows CE预制平台SDK掌上电脑1.1中文版使用指南
- 21DT数控车床编程指南:操作与编程指令详解
- 随机化算法:原理、设计与应用探索
- PB编程入门:核心函数详解与知识架构构建
- Ant实战教程:从入门到精通
- DB2 SQL语法指南:从创建到索引详解
- Java GUI设计入门:AWT与Swing解析
- VCL 7.0继承关系详解:完整对象树与可用版本区分
- 十天精通ASP.NET:从安装到实战
- 有效软件测试的关键策略
- ARM ADS1.2开发环境与AXD调试教程
- 详述JSTL:核心、I18N、SQL与XML标签库解析
- ×××论坛系统概要设计说明书